Job Description

CATEGORY MANAGEMENT

In the International Category Management team you will be closely involved in the deployment of winning category strategies to all our global markets. This includes collaboration with local markets, leveraging shopper and commercial insights as well as trends to create value-adding content for our global platforms and support category management projects with retailers. A key part of this role will be coordinating with local teams around the world and assisting with shelf space reviews and Global category training. 

INTERNATIONAL KEY ACCOUNT MANAGEMENT

In our International Key Account team, you will gain broad experience within the various sales channels and customers – both from an Headquarter perspective as well as a from a country market view. You will support the HQ team with analysing sales and shopper data, help to develop conceptual sells and presentations for customer negotiations, furthermore, support in the annual business planning process by information gathering and feedback preparation. Additionally, you will be able to work independently on special projects in the area of customer profitability and omnichannel Key Account management. You will work closely with the local Red Bull teams from all over the world and facilitate best practice sharing sessions for specific channels and market clusters.

SALES ANALYTCIS & BUSINESS APPLICATION

As our business expands, there is a growing demand for analytics and the implementation of a new Sales Execution Tracking Tool. You will work on analytics projects, build compelling data visualizations and provide insights to fulfil the increasing reporting and analytics needs of our On Premise Sales department. Additionally, you will closely work together with the team that manages the implementation and global rollout of the new Sales Execution Tracking Tool. This is a unique opportunity to contribute to the growth and success of Red Bull by leveraging your analytical skills and assisting in the implementation of innovative tools.

ON PREMISE DISTRIBUTION & KEY ACCOUNTS

In the On Premise Key Account and Distribution Team you will support in managing our top Global Key Account partners while also working on acquisition, management, and growth of other established Global and Regional partnerships. Our overall strategy and partnerships around the world need to be profitable, efficient, and ensuring a continuous development of our brand. You will be responsible to collect and track Global agreements and streamline the available data sources. You will also play a vital role in the yearly business planning, by adapting and improving the planning template and collecting viable feedback from across the markets.

EVENTS & FESTIVALS

The Global On Premise Events & Festivals team is leading the global Event & Festival strategy and supports local Red Bull teams to deliver impactful Third-Party Event executions and inspiring B2C & B2B events. You will be working closely with other On Premise teams, HQ departments as well as the local Event & Festival managers to experience first-hand global strategy & project roll-out, starting from the very first idea until the final execution incl. commercialisation and content creation. A key part of this role will be to support the HQ Events & Festivals team alongside various projects with guidelines, tracking & reporting and insights while also driving your own projects.
